Changed defaults in Splitfork, our assignment service. Bucketing now uses sticky hashing per account instead of per session, and the holdout slice grew from 2% to 5%. Callers relying on session-level reassignment must opt in explicitly. Review the diff against the new baseline; the updated default configuration is listed below.

config for tagep-kajof:
[casir]
port = 6379
region = south-1
host = casir.paliqdyn.example
team = tamax
timeout_ms = 250
retries = 2

Ticket #4471 — Locker assignment, Building C changing rooms

Hey team assistants — we've reshuffled the lockers after the Brindlewood move. New joiners get lockers 30–58; please stop handing out anything below 30, those belong to the pool staff now. Spare padlocks are in the supply cupboard by the showers.

To open the locker admin panel, enter the code below.

staff pass of haweg-bafop = bdg-G-69

// Sets up the client for the Pinwheel loyalty-points ledger.
// All point accruals and redemptions go through this service;
// never write balances directly to the cache. The ledger is
// append-only, so corrections are issued as reversal entries.
// Retries are safe because every request carries an idempotency
// token generated here. The client authenticates to Pinwheel
// using the service key below.

service key, fawip-bajef: kto11_Qt5wZK9vdNC

Test plan for the Fernlock Hub firmware update channel: plugin authors should push a signed build to the staging ring, wait for the rollout manifest to refresh (roughly five minutes), then confirm the device reports the new version string via /status. Rollbacks must also be exercised once per release cycle. All staging-ring requests are authenticated; attach the bearer token provided below to every call.

portal login ticket: eyJhbGciOiJIUzI1NiIsInR5cCI6IkpXVCJ9.eyJzdWIiOiIMjvRAf3PEFIn0.nuv9gjixLtnr